On National Doctors’ Day, say thanks to your favorite physician

 

National Doctors’ Day is March 30, but UT Health San Antonio will be celebrating doctors the entire week of March 25.

 

Sir William Osler, one of the four founding professors of Johns Hopkins Hospital once said, “The good physician treats the disease; the great physician treats the patient who has the disease.”

 

And so it is with our physicians.  We thank them and recognize them for their unwavering commitment to the mission and the sacrifices that go along with that dedication.
